Join our team and play a key role in keeping our Electric operations running smoothly!

In this hands-on position, you'll source and evaluate vendor materials, manage requisitions from start to finish, maintain accurate inventory and budget records, and ensure equipment and supplies meet quality standards. You'll support field crews with essential materials, keep warehouse operations organized and compliant, assist with minor equipment repairs (which may include welding), maintenance and painting, and contribute to our salvage and recycling efforts. If you enjoy a mix of coordination, problem-solving, and active field support-while building strong working relationships across the organization-this role is a great fit.

Minimum Qualifications

EXPERIENCE AND TRAINING

Electric Materials Technician I

Experience:

One year of increasingly responsible experience working in an industrial, construction or warehouse environment. Experience in purchasing and warehousing of tools, materials and equipment is desirable.

AND

Training:

Equivalent to the completion of the twelfth (12th) grade, GED, or higher level degree.

License or Certificate:

Possession of a valid California Class C driver's license by date of appointment.

Possession of, or ability to obtain a valid California Class A driver's license within six months of appointment.

Electric Materials Technician II

In addition to the qualifications for the Electric Materials Technician I:

Experience:

Two years of experience performing duties similar to that of an Electric Materials Technician I in the City of Roseville.

AND

Training:

Equivalent to the completion of the twelfth (12th) grade, GED, or higher level degree.

License or Certificate:

Possession of a valid California Class C driver's license by date of appointment.

If assigned to Electric Distribution Operations, possession of, or ability to obtain, a valid California Class A driver's license within six months of appointment.
